Q: Is 113,321,212 a Prime Number?

 A: No, 113,321,212 is not a prime number.

Why is 113,321,212 not a prime number?

A prime number is a natural number, greater than one, that can only be divided by 1 and itself.

The number 113321212 can be evenly divided by 1 2 4 29 41 58 82 116 164 1,189 2,378 4,756 23,827 47,654 95,308 690,983 976,907 1,381,966 1,953,814 2,763,932 3,907,628 28,330,303 56,660,606 and 113,321,212, with no remainder.

Since 113,321,212 cannot be divided by just 1 and 113,321,212, it is not a prime number.
